On 20th July 1998,"Bio-medical waste (Management and Handling) Rules were framed. 1st Amendment on 06-03-2000. 2nd Amendment on 17-09-2003.

On 28th March 2016, Under Environment (Protection) Act, 1986, MoEF&CC notified the new BMW Rules, 2016 and replaced the earlier Rules(1988). DEFINITION Bio- medical waste means "any solid and /or liquid waste produced during diagnosis, treatment or vaccination of human beings.Biomedical waste creates hazard due to two principal reasons: infectivity and toxicity.
